How do you hang your projects - what type of hanging device do you use/create? I usually just poke a hole at the top for a nail or small piece of leather knotted together. Another teacher I know makes little button like pieces of clay,slightly flattened, with a horizontal depression (side of a pencil), She fires these buttons along with the project , and attaches them with E600 after firing. The depression forms a tunnel through which you can thread a string fof hanging. Is there some way to make a hanging device on the back, with clay, before firing? What about some type of bent wire?
